    3. >From The Heritage Newsletter, 1 Apr 2003 [email protected] >From "The Capital," the Annapolis, Maryland, newspaper of 17 March 2003, we learn that the State of Maryland is start- ing a new program whereby librarians will be available to chat with residents with questions, 24-hours a day, 7-days a week! The librarians staffing the system will come from 20 public library systems and 5 academic libraries, including the Maryland Law Library in Annapolis. To access the system Maryland residents need to log onto the website of their local library, or at www.askusnow.info. Delays are said to be small, and the librarian and patron are able to view documents simultaneously. The article reports that a similar system has been in oper- ation in New Jersey for over a year with good results. ****************** Charles County Public Library, Prince George's Memorial Library, and Cecil County Public Library are on the list of participating libraries.
